Broadway stalwart Patti LuPone is coming to the Twin Cities for two nights of intimate performances.
LuPone, who won Tonys for playing Eva Perón in "Evita" and Mama Rose in the 2000 revival of "Gypsy," will hold forth at the Dakota jazz club and restaurant on Sept. 12th and 13th. She will deliver songs by the likes of Cole Porter and Johnny Mercer for a new, travel-themed show called "Far Away Places."Â
Tickets range from $35-$70 and are available at the 1010 Nicollet Mall, Mpls; by phone, 612-332-5299; or online.Â
